Gram panchayat finances, 2024–25

XV Finance Commission grant for Dhanali panchayat, Vadgam zila parishad. These are the panchayat's own accounts, not this village's: where a panchayat holds several villages, the money covers all of them, and where a village spans several panchayats only this one's return appears.

Opening balance
₹4.93 lakh
Received from state (auto-transfer)
₹12.04 lakh
Received directly
₹7.53 lakh
Spent
₹15.69 lakh
Unspent at year end
₹8.80 lakh
Untied (basic grant)
opened ₹2.29 lakh · received ₹4.81 lakh · spent ₹7.09 lakh · left ₹4.86 lakh
Tied (earmarked)
opened ₹2.64 lakh · received ₹7.22 lakh · spent ₹8.59 lakh · left ₹3.94 lakh

Source: eGramSwaraj, as reported by the panchayat. Untied and tied together make up the totals above.
